#14e68b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14e68b is composed of 7.8% red, 90.2%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 154 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 49%. #14e68b color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00cd17.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#14e68b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14e68b has RGB values of R:20, G:230,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1369739.

Shades and Tints of #14e68b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d08 is the darkest color, while #fafff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#14e68b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74867e is the less saturated color, while #01f98e is the most saturated one.
